Lei

Results 10 comments of Lei

您好,我发现这一部分 ``` while (l pivot) { swap(nums[l++], nums[r--]); } if (nums[l] >= pivot) ++l; if (nums[r]

想问下,解法一中的 `root->left = deleteNode(root->left, key);` 为什么不是`return deleteNode(root->left, key);`

> 想问下,解法一中的 `root->left = deleteNode(root->left, key);` 为什么不是`return deleteNode(root->left, key);` 是不是:如果只是找到这个node就是递归中直接`return`, 但是这里并不是,而是找到之后remove/modify etc. 所以是赋值给root.left或者root.right

您好, 请问"需要另一个下标`t`,用来拷贝所有满足 `sums[t] < sums[i]` 到一个寄存器 Cache 中以完成混合排序的过程", 这句话是什么意思啊? 我不是很懂`t`和`cache1在这里的作用

Pruning in backtracking is really a thing ... I wonder how you become a master of it

这个自定义的排序真简便

解法二厉害了,就是用独一无二的状态压缩标记

这怎么想到是bfs的?我一开始看觉得是trie,后来发现不对怎么都做不出来

博主好,对最后的`board[i]][j] = c`这个回溯,你觉得什么时候应该写啊? 我看比如像`200. Number of Islands`纯粹的dfs就没有,但是像这种backtracking就要回溯。是不是因为那道题只是“相邻的island”全部0变成1,只要变成1就是属于当前island后面就不用再检验;而这里word的检验,如果不相等后面还要回到原点进行检验? 不知道我说清楚没有,我感觉这种区别很微妙

I'm curious, did you guys seriously read all words one by one on this list?